可重复使用消费模式的未来.pdf
可重复使用消费模式的未来.pdf
可重复使用的消费模式的未来报告.pdf
会出现重复消费的情况,但实际测试后发现,在版本有差异的情况下(客户端3.5.8版本,服务端4.2.0版本),采用集群模式消费,未出现重复消费的情况,采用广播模式时,会出现重复消费的情况。 Rocketmq 消费者分 集群...
造成RabbitMq重复消费的原因,以及如何解决RabbitMq的重复消费。
kafka重复消费原因及解决方案
文章目录RabbitMQ如何防止消息丢失及重复消费一、消息丢失1.1、生产者没有成功把消息发送到MQ1.1.1、confirm(发布确认)机制1.1.2、事务机制1.2、RabbitMQ接收到消息之后丢失了消息1.3、消费者弄丢了消息二、如何...
RocketMQ提供了两种消息的消费模式,拉模式和推模式。我们先来看一下拉模式消费的应用。
生产者(Producer)和消费者(Consumer)是通过发布订阅模式进行协作的,生产者将消息发送到Kafka集群,而消费者从Kafka集群中拉取消息进行消费,无论是生产者发送消息到Kafka集群还是消费者从Kafka集群中拉取消息...
本文介绍RabbitMQ消息重复的原因以及解决方案(即:如何保证消息不重复消费)。
1、负载均衡模式(集群模式) 消费者采用负载均衡方式消费消息,一个分组(Group)下的多个消费者共同消费队列消息...集群消费模式是消费者默认的消费方式。 代码中由这一行代码控制: // 消费模式 默认是集群模式.
本文对应源码地址:https://github.com/nieandsun/rocketmq-study rocketmq官网:https://rocketmq.apache.org/docs/quick-start/ rocketmq github托管地址(这里直接给出的是中文docs地址):... 文章目录1 1 ...
重复消费问题: 为了解决消费端因为种种原因而造成的消息丢失问题,我们都知道根源在于因为RabbitMQ的自动ack机制,所以为了避免以上问题,我们会选中手动ack,以确保消息不会因为某些原因而丢失。 但随之而来的也有...
标签: java
RabbitConfig /** * @author fan * @date 2022年04月27日 11:17 */ @EnableRabbit @Configuration public class RabbitConfig { ... private String fanoutQueueName = "fanoutQueue";... private String fanoutEx.
发送到死信队列中的消息需要取出来进行消费,转发到原有队列重新消费 一是在客户端做幂等性处理 二是消息有唯一编号,消费完的消息,存到消息表里,这样做去重。 第二种对消息系统的吞吐量有巨大的需求,能用...
消息队列,顺序消费、消息防丢、防止消息重复消费、解决消息积压。分布式事务可靠消息最终一致性
消息队列在数据传输的过程中,为了保证消息传递的可靠性,一般会对消息采用ack确认机制,如果消息传递失败,消息队列会进行重试,此时便可能存在消息重复消费的问题。 比如,用户到银行取钱后会收到扣款通知短信,...
如何解决rocketmq消息重复消费
RabbitMq消费者一直循环重复消费信息 消费者消息签收模式为自动时,如果消费端处理出现异常并且被抛出了,该条消息就会一直被重新消费。如果对生产者传递给消费者的实体数据结构进行了更改,而此时队列中还有...
在使用消息队列时不可避免的会遇到顺序消费、重复消费、消息丢失三个问题。在一次面试字节的时候,面试官问到如何保证顺序消费,当时回答不太准确,特意此文回顾如何解决顺序消费、重复消费、消息丢失三个问题。 ...
问题现场 博主正在负责一个数据服务平台,某一天...其原因是由于数据量过大,日志无法观察到进行了重复消费。 最后实在排查无果,本着快速解决的原则,于是博主开发了一套数据去重机制,就这样问题暂时解决了。 p......